The station opens its ticket office doors early, from 5:40 AM to 00:10 AM on weekdays, ensuring you can purchase or collect your tickets with ease. With ticket machines available, and the ability to collect tickets bought online, planning your journey at Huyton is hassle-free. The station has been designed for accessibility with features like induction loops and accessible ticket machines. A noteworthy point is the level access available throughout the station, making it a Category A station for accessibility.
For those with special needs, staff assistance is available every day, and you can use the helpline service 24/7 to arrange for special travel assistance via the Passenger Assist program.
Huyton station serves as a key node with connections to various modes of transportation. A dedicated rail replacement bus service operates when necessary, while ample taxi services are also accessible. Located just 250 yards away is the main bus station, further complementing the transport links for passengers.
The lack of bicycle hire services might be a hindrance for some cyclists, but there's accommodating bicycle storage available within the car park for those riding their own bikes.

Although modest in size and services, Hunmanby Train Station offers essential facilities for travelers. While there isn't a ticket office on-site, passengers can collect their pre-purchased tickets using an accessible ticket machine located on Platform 2. For your auditory needs, an induction loop is in place. If you're planning your travel, the station ensures accessibility with step-free access to platforms via a level crossing ramp, making it convenient for all passengers, including those with wheelchairs.
For those in need of assistance, note that the station is unstaffed. However, customer help points are available, and you can contact the helpline at 08002006060 for support. Additionally, boarding ramps are carried on all trains arriving at the station. Whether it's last-minute travel arrangements or assistance bookings, they can be made up to 2 hours before your journey.
Hunmanby Station integrates well with other transport modes. While there are no buses directly servicing the station, Rail Replacement Services are accessible nearby for those needing to travel when regular services are disrupted. Should you choose to grab a cab, explore options through Northern Railway's Cab4You service, which can be handy for quick and direct transport solutions.
